[[https://www.uniprot.org/uniprot/DESV_STRVZ DESV_STRVZ]] Involved in the biosynthesis of dTDP-alpha-D-desosamine, a sugar found in several bacterial macrolide antibiotics. Catalyzes the reversible transfer of the amino group from L-glutamate to the C-3 position of dTDP-3-keto-4,6-deoxyglucose to yield dTDP-3-amino-3,4,6-trideoxyglucose.<ref>PMID:17456741</ref>
